M10.351 vs M10.352

M10.351 (Gout due to renal impairment, right hip) compared with M10.352 (Gout due to renal impairment, left hip), from the official CMS tabular data. M10.351 and M10.352 code the same condition on opposite sides.

Same condition; these differ only in which side is documented.

These codes share a category and title and differ only in the side affected. The documentation decides which applies, and a bilateral code is reported only where the code set provides one.
